Transaction f943955e414bb8aed7ded24abaef3c7d73e83c76f33195a8dda16f6021733121
1 Input
1 Output
-
f943955e414bb8aed7ded24abaef3c7d73e83c76f33195a8dda16f6021733121:0
- value
- 650425
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 396b87ba6eb8394694b351c43ffaac5ac03d7e7f OP_EQUAL
- address
- 36vdFojY8NiJDuwvn19uaHQZAdxQgZNAba